- No application log found ?The SAP error message /ISDFPS/SYNC333 No application log found typically occurs in the context of the SAP IS-DFPS (Industry Solution for Defense Forces and Security) module. This error indicates that the system is unable to find an application log that is expected for a certain process or transaction.
Cause: Missing Log Entries: The application log that the system is trying to access may not exist. This can happen if the log was never created or if it was deleted. Incorrect Log ID: The log ID being referenced may be incorrect or not properly specified in the transaction.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to view the application logs. System Configuration: There may be issues with the configuration of the logging mechanism in the system.
